		<title>New FHA Costs Add to Monthly Payment</title>
		<link>http://www.come2ok.com/for-home-buyers/new-fha-costs-add-to-monthly-payment/</link>
		<comments>http://www.come2ok.com/for-home-buyers/new-fha-costs-add-to-monthly-payment/#comments</comments>
		<pubDate>Tue, 20 Mar 2012 14:25:12 +0000</pubDate>
		<dc:creator>Wayne</dc:creator>
				<category><![CDATA[For Home Buyers]]></category>

		<guid isPermaLink="false">http://www.come2ok.com/?p=2077</guid>
		<description><![CDATA[<p>Upfront Mortgage Insurance Premiums (UFMIP) will be increasing to 1.75% regardless of loan term, beginning with all Case Numbers assigned on or after April 1, 2012.</p> <p>Annual Premiums (collected monthly) will increase by .10% for all loan amounts under $625,000.00, beginning with all Case Numbers assigned on or after April 1, 2012.</p> <p>FHA was given [...]]]></description>
